Kamdyn Guthridge places fourth at Peewee state tournament

Akron-Westfield youth wrestler Kamdyn Guthridge placed fourth at the recent Super Peewee State Tournament.

Kamdyn was in a 32 man bracket and lost his first round but  battled back and won his next five matches to earn his place on the podium. 

Legion hosts Pancake Feed for baseball team

Albert E. Hoschler Post No. 186 of The American Legion hosted a  Pancake Feed Feb. 24 at the Akron Legion Hall to raise funds for its Junior League baseball team. 

For $10 all you can eat pancakes were served along with eggs, sausage, and drink. Coaches, team members, parents, and friends all helped with the successful feed.

Cole St. Pierre places 7th at youth state wrestling

Cole St. Pierre of Akron placed seventh at the 2024 Iowa AAU State Wrestling Tournament in his division Feb. 24 and 25 at Wells Fargo Arena in Des Moines. A-W youth wrestlers Joshua Webb and Carter Utesch also wrestled at the state tournament but did not place.
